Transponder Keys

Transponder keys are utilized in most modern cars to connect with the car's device. They transmit and receive radio signals. This device, sometimes referred to as an immobilizer, prevents the car from beginning if it isn't programmed to operate at the correct frequency. Transponder keys are more difficult to duplicate than mechanical keys. They require special equipment and programming. This makes them harder for novice car thieves to hook up with hot wire, although it does not mean they are invincible.

Transponder keys differ from mechanical keys. They have an embedded chip in the head of the key. The head of the transponder key is also a bit larger than a regular metal key.

To function the transponder chip needs to transmit a coded signal to the ECU (Engine Control Unit) of the vehicle. Once the ECU has recognized the correct code, it will begin to start the car. The distance a chip can be read varies depending on the type and age of the car. For instance, in order for most modern cars to start keys must be within seven inches of the vehicle.

Since transponder chips can only be transmitted when the key is close to the vehicle, it's important to keep the key away from metal objects and other electronic components. It's also important not to place the key in proximity to magnetic fields, as they can interfere with its operation.

Transponder keys are more expensive to produce than conventional keys, but the cost is well worth it for the extra security they offer. The key must be cut and programmed to match the code on the computer system of your vehicle and requires special tools and equipment. Laser cut car keys are different from traditional keys in that they have slits on both sides. This design allows the keys to be inserted in any direction into the ignition or door cylinder lock, and still function. They are also a little heavier than regular keys due the fact that they are more robust.

Laser cut keys are more difficult to copy than traditional keys. They also come with transponder chips in, which are unique to your vehicle. Even if a burglar is able to duplicate your key, they will not be able to start your vehicle.

Laser keys are an excellent option for people looking for more security. It is difficult to find the special equipment needed to duplicate and make keys in the general hardware stores. They have a unique design on each one, making it harder for thieves to use keys from other vehicles to unlock and start them.
